Understanding Crash Gambling Mechanics

Crash games, a relatively new phenomenon in the online casino world, have quickly gained popularity due to their fast-paced nature and potentially high payouts. The core concept is remarkably simple: a multiplier starts at 1x and increases over time. Players place bets before each round and can “cash out” at any point to secure their winnings based on the current multiplier. The game ends randomly, often referred to as a “crash,” and any players who haven’t cashed out lose their stake. This inherent unpredictability is what makes the game thrilling, but also what necessitates a careful and strategic approach. Understanding the random number generator (RNG) that governs these games is fundamental. Reputable platforms employ certified RNGs to ensure fairness and prevent manipulation, but it's still crucial to be aware that each round is independent and past results do not influence future outcomes.

The Role of Provably Fair Technology

A key feature that differentiates trustworthy crash gambling platforms is the implementation of “provably fair” technology. This system allows players to verify the randomness of each game round, providing transparency and building confidence in the platform’s integrity. Provably fair systems use cryptographic algorithms to generate verifiable seeds which, when combined, determine the outcome of the game. Players can independently audit these seeds to ensure that the results are not pre-determined or rigged. Before engaging with any crash game, players should investigate whether the platform utilizes this technology and understand how it works. This level of transparency is a strong indicator of a platform's commitment to fairness and responsible gaming.

Implementing auto-cash out features is a very good practice. The auto-cash out feature enables users to set a multiplier at which their bet will automatically be cashed out, removing the pressure to react quickly and drawing on emotional decisions. This can be invaluable in managing risk and preventing chasing losses.

Strategies for Responsible Betting

Responsible betting isn't about avoiding gambling altogether; it’s about maintaining control and making informed decisions. Establishing a budget is the foundational step. Determine a specific amount of money you are comfortable losing and stick to it, regardless of wins or losses. Treat this money as entertainment expenses, not as a potential source of income. Furthermore, it’s essential to avoid chasing losses. The impulse to recoup lost funds by increasing bets often leads to a downward spiral. Accept that losses are a part of gambling and avoid emotional decision-making. Instead, view each bet as an independent event and make choices based on your pre-defined strategy and budget. Recognizing the signs of problem gambling is equally important.

Identifying and Addressing Problem Gambling

Problem gambling can manifest in various ways, often starting subtly and escalating over time. Signs include spending increasing amounts of time and money on gambling, neglecting personal responsibilities, lying to friends and family about gambling habits, and experiencing feelings of irritability or restlessness when trying to cut back. If you or someone you know is exhibiting these behaviors, it’s vital to seek help. Numerous resources are available, including self-exclusion programs, counseling services, and support groups. Self-exclusion allows you to voluntarily ban yourself from gambling platforms for a specified period. Counseling provides a safe space to address the underlying issues contributing to problem gambling, while support groups offer a sense of community and shared experience.

Evaluating Platform Security and Legitimacy

Before depositing any funds into an online casino, it’s imperative to verify its legitimacy and security. Look for platforms that are licensed and regulated by reputable authorities, such as the Malta Gaming Authority or the UK Gambling Commission. Licensing indicates that the platform adheres to strict standards of fairness, security, and responsible gambling. Additionally, check for secure socket layer (SSL) encryption, indicated by "https" in the website address and a padlock icon in the browser. SSL encryption protects your personal and financial information from being intercepted by hackers. Reading reviews from other players can also provide valuable insights into the platform’s reputation and reliability. However, be cautious of biased or fake reviews.

Understanding Terms and Conditions

Thoroughly reviewing the terms and conditions of any online casino is often overlooked, but it is crucial. Pay close attention to clauses regarding bonuses, wagering requirements, withdrawal limits, and account verification procedures. Wagering requirements specify how many times you must wager a bonus amount before you can withdraw any winnings. Withdrawal limits restrict the maximum amount you can withdraw in a given period. Account verification requires you to provide documentation to prove your identity and address. Understanding these terms will prevent any surprises or disputes down the line. The goal is to ensure transparent policies and fair practices.
